    Trials & Tribulations

    But as the days turned into weeks, my enthusiasm began to wane, revealing an unsettling truth beneath the surface. One glaring issue made itself apparent: **the performance** often lagged when I pushed it with multiple tabs or heavier applications. I was so annoyed when simple tasks like streaming music while working caused stuttering and delays. My inner creative cringed every time I had to sit there impatiently waiting for programs to load.

    I also discovered the touchpad sensitivity left much to be desired. Imagine trying to scroll through documents or websites only for your cursor to jump around erratically! It felt like my trusty steed was stumbling beneath me during our ride through ideas and inspiration. For a laptop marketed towards students and professionals, these shortcomings were frustrating setbacks.

    Moments of Glory

    Yet amid the trials arose moments that made me smile with joy. The battery life, oh sweet salvation! On one particularly hectic Tuesday, I needed to work remotely at a coffee shop all day without access to a charger. To my delight, the HP 14s-dq5000 lasted six hours on a single charge! This genuinely impressed me; it felt like a breath of fresh air when others struggled while tethered to their cords.

    Another highlight came in the form of its **display quality**—bright colors popped in movies and images alike. Watching YouTube videos where vibrant hues danced across the screen filled me with glee! There’s something cathartic about immersing oneself in rich visuals after a long day of digital demands.

    The Tragic Flaws

    However, amidst those fleeting joyful moments lurked deeply unsettling flaws that left scars on my experience with this device. **The build quality fell short of expectations**, and I remember feeling crushed by this reality when I accidentally dropped it from a low height onto carpet but still witnessed minor dents upon inspection—it felt disappointing that such delicacy plagued my supposed 'travel companion.'

    Finally, let’s talk about **the speakers**; they leave much to be desired as well! Listening to music or catching up on podcasts became painful when sound distorted at higher volumes—a ghostly whisper where vibrant sound should fill my space. For this price range, I expected better fidelity!
